Six Useful Approaches To Help Your Teenager Obtain Much Better Grades

To aid your teen obtain better grades, think about enrolling your kid to a teenagers club, showing your own child some help, helping him with his homework, aiding your teenager get organized, requiring him some hours for school work, and establishing some positive and negative reinforcements.
Teenagers, these days, are confronted with various issues and challenges which get in their way of getting good grades. Family troubles, social challenges, along with distractions brought about by technology, such as television, the internet, and also video games, make it hard for them to concentrate on their studies. As a parent, it is your obligation to follow up on your teens to help them flourish with their education. Here are a few effective suggestions you can take note to aid your teen get better grades:
Consider enrolling your kid to a teens club
There are various clubs your adolescent could join to help him boost his grades. These kinds of groups which you usually find in schools give teen help in organizing their time, setting goals right, and doing things correctly without having to stay a boring teenage life.
Show your child some help
Teens who're underachievers only require your support as well as inspiration to obtain their full potential. Show your own kid that you value him by asking him how he is doing with his class work, if he has been taking part in any sports activity or other extra-curricular activities, or if there's anything you can perform to help him. A bit of concern from you concerning his school life can give your teen a boost, which could result to better grades.
Aid him with his homework
While some students like performing things on their own, some still feel they can utilize some help from others. Without him asking you, approach your kid and offer to assist him with his home work. Perform this in a concerned and interested manner, so that he will not hesitate to obtain some help from you the next time. A healthy parent-student relationship like this will surely help your teen get excellent grades.
Aid your teenager get organized
Your adolescent may just lack some sense of order that's why he is not getting excellent grades. Assist him get organized by obtaining him notebooks, a planner, a workspace calendar, a cork board, notepads, and a few sticky notes which he can utilize to handle his activities, and also take note of school's deadlines.
Demand him some hours for class work
Though it is important not to appear very imposing on your child, it is also very important to set a daily schedule for him to perform his homework if you need him to obtain better grades. Even though some kids are liable enough to do this, your child may just be distracted by buddies and engrossed with some other activities that he fails to do his homework. He should devote at least a few hours each day with no tv, no unnecessary browsing of the Internet and no games to aid him get great grades.
Set a few negative and positive reinforcements
Inspiration is an extremely important tool to help your adolescent obtain good grades. Don't be afraid to praise your kid and reward him for his great grades, as well as discipline him for his low grades to keep him inspired. Please do not employ physical punishment since this can only worsen your child's situation. Rather, make a deal with your teen, and let him know that there will be specific rewards as well as consequences for school results which are suitable to both of you. Adhere to your deal to get some consistency in your approach.
Every single adolescent responds in a different way to various techniques, so make sure you improvise to determine what tip works best for your adolescent. As long as you give your teen some assurance that you are always there to support him with everything he does, things will be easier for the both of you, and school grades will be far better than before.
